ProQuest Dissertations & Theses: UK & Ireland to be discontinued

ProQuest Dissertations and Theses: UK & Ireland has been discontinued and has now merged with ProQuest Dissertations and Theses: Abstracts & Index (PQDT:AI).

You can access PQDT: AI database via the Databases A-Z page:

Multidisciplinary subject coverage is available with access provided to the following:

-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: Business
-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: Health & Medicine
-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: History
-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: Literature and Language
-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: Science and Technology
-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: Social Science
-ProQuest Dissertations & Theses A&I: The Arts

Endnote Web and Emerald

Due to technical issues, when exporting citations to Emerald, make sure to edit the author name's in your Endnote Web Library. 

The best option is to export the details as a RIS file 

With this option however, the names are entered in the wrong order i.e. First name in place of surname, so remember to change this once the references are in your Endnote Web library

We hope to see a fix for this at the end of July. Apologies for the inconvenience.
